You need to scroll to the right to see the whole screen.
That's your fault, not theirs. You have your monitor's resolution set too small to display the whole thing. Bring it up to at least 1024x768 (preferably 1280x1024) and you'll be fine. If your monitor doesn't support that high of a resolution, well... frankly I'm amazed that it even still operates at all.

I know your response will be, "But other sites display just fine on my dark ages resolution!" Lots of sites these days are written using code that allows the page to be malleable and adjust to fit your individual resolution. These sites are primarily comparitively simpler places, such as news sites. The Cyclones web site is using a lot of banners and pictures and interactive doodads, all of which have a fixed width, unlike text. If a sentence is too long to display, a computer can just shove the last few words down onto a new line. You can't do that with pictures and Java stuff.
